31a27a9ccc
such as flash memory, Disk-On-Chip, or ROM. Includes mkfs.jffs2, a tool to create JFFS2 (journaling flash file system) filesystems.
33 lines
863 B
Makefile
33 lines
863 B
Makefile
# $NetBSD: Makefile,v 1.1.1.1 2007/10/20 15:32:11 noud4 Exp $
|
|
#
|
|
|
|
DISTNAME= mtd-utils-1.0.0
|
|
CATEGORIES= wip
|
|
MASTER_SITES= ftp://ftp.infradead.org/pub/mtd-utils/
|
|
|
|
MAINTAINER= noud4@home.nl
|
|
HOMEPAGE= http://www.linux-mtd.infradead.org/
|
|
COMMENT= Memory Technology Device Tools
|
|
|
|
USE_TOOLS+= gmake
|
|
USE_LANGUAGES= c c++
|
|
#CFLAGS+= -D_NETBSD_SOURCE
|
|
|
|
SUBST_CLASSES+= paths
|
|
SUBST_FILES.paths= Makefile
|
|
SUBST_SED.paths+= -e 's,@PREFIX@,${PREFIX},g'
|
|
SUBST_STAGE.paths= post-patch
|
|
|
|
pre-build:
|
|
cp ${FILESDIR}/include/mtd_swab.h ${WRKSRC}/include
|
|
|
|
post-build:
|
|
cd ${WRKSRC}/checkfs && ${MAKE}
|
|
cd ${WRKSRC}/jittertest && ${MAKE}
|
|
|
|
post-install:
|
|
${INSTALL_PROGRAM} ${WRKSRC}/checkfs/checkfs ${PREFIX}/sbin
|
|
${INSTALL_PROGRAM} ${WRKSRC}/jittertest/JitterTest ${PREFIX}/sbin
|
|
${INSTALL_PROGRAM} ${WRKSRC}/jittertest/plotJittervsFill ${PREFIX}/sbin
|
|
|
|
.include "../../mk/bsd.pkg.mk"
|